We are moving to the beautiful Switzerland. We checked out from hotel early in the morning. Too early that we encounter several drunks along the way. We reached the bus station and nearly miss our bus to Orly! That was some adrenaline rush. Bus tickets can be purchased at the machine. We were lucky to hop in the bus just in time.

We were flying with EasyJet for all inter-flights. Verdict? It was great for a no-frills airline. Airport security in Europe are pretty strict. They take my stuff out just because I have a pen inside on my backpack. You have to segregrate your items in different trays. Yes, imagine how long it takes. Having done research, I always put the items to be separated at the top so it will be easier. For readers out there, in Malaysia, the airport security is not as strict as in Europe.

Just like other budget airlines, they offer sale of food and drinks onboard. While the smell of coffee temp me, I choose to sleep during the 1 hour plus flight to Geneva. The view was stunning as you passed above the French and Swiss Alps. Truly, magnificent. We were arriving at Geneva and I noticed the airport is in the middle of the valley of mountains. Gulp! And they descend to rapidly and steeply and it made my heart jump! Not only that, they do a sharp U-turn while descending due to the runway location. I almost had a nervous breakdown – we landed safe and sound.

Made a quick toilet break, buy snacks and continue our journey to Interlaken. Interlaken is a small charming town – small enough you can walk to the centre. We made a stop at the train station to buy our Jungfraujoch Top of Europe tickets. Checked in the hotel, have lunch and rest a bit before venturing out.

Interlaken means between lakes – the town is located between Lake Brienz and Thun. We took the car and began to explore the lake. On our way, the houses, the fields in Interlaken offers a charm that continue to linger in our hearts. The traditional house with their family names placed on top of the doorway and the lake of course. We finally found a parking spot – let’s face it, we did not plan an exact place to stop. This moment is truly a “not all who wander are lost” moment. We stopped at a small lakeside residence that is beautiful. They have cottages on the lake side with a beautiful backdrop of the Alps. Subhanallah!!!! Heaven on earth. We chase cats, take photos, have short strolls before heading to Lauterbrunnen.
